Reader 除了提供文件读取功能外,还内置了解码功能,因此说,
转载
2013-01-14 17:39:00
94阅读
/* File类: 用于描述一个文件或者文件夹的。 通过File对象我们可以读取文件或者文件夹的属性数据,如果我们需要读取文件的内容数据,那么我们需要使用IO流技术。 IO流(Input Output) IO流解决问题: 解决设备与设备之间的数据传输问题。 内存--->硬盘 硬盘--->内存 IO流技术: IO流分类: 如果是按照数据的流向划分: ...
转载
2017-02-12 01:06:00
145阅读
2评论
上篇文章中我们介绍了需要掌握的16个流,先来介绍其中最常用的文件流。1.FileInputStreamFileInputStream是文件字节输入流,从硬盘中读数据(read)到内存,并且是万能流,可传输任何类型的数据。(1)怎么new对象?一个类可以怎么new对象,取决于它的构造方法,所以,面向api文档编程又来了。它有三个构造方法,先拿一个我们现在看得懂的:FileInputStream(St
转载
2023-07-06 15:23:17
255阅读
一、IO流的类层次图一个流被定义为一个数据序列。输入流用于从源读取数据,输出流用于向目标写数据。下图是一个描述输入流和输出流的类层次图。 粘贴自菜鸟教程-JAVA-流二、FileInputStream2.1概念FileInputStream流被称为文件字节输入流,意思指对文件数据以字节的形式进行读取操作如读取图片视频等2.2构造方法可用字符串类型的文件名来创建一个输入流对象来读取文件:InputS
转载
2023-07-26 08:50:59
88阅读
FileInputStream和FileReader的区别1 ) File 类介绍 File 类封装了对用户机器的文件系统进行操作的功能。例如,可以用 File 类获得文件上次修改的时间,移动,或者对文件进行删除、重命名。换句话说,流类关注的是文件内容,而 File 类关注的是文件在磁盘上的存储 F
package p7.uploadpic;
import java.io.File;
import java.io.FileInputStream;
import java.io.IOException;
import java.io.InputStream;
import java.io.OutputStream;
import java.net.Socket;
import java.net
转载
2023-06-08 12:34:28
121阅读
前言前面一章我们对文件(File)和IO流进行了了解,分别介绍了:FileInputStreamFileOutputStreamFileReaderFileWriter上面这些是重点,我们一定要掌握还重点强调了关于IO流的流向问题: 已程序为参照物从文件到程序是输入流从程序到文件是输出流如果不清楚的话,建议去上一节看看这里我先给大家看一张图,上面罗列了一些可能会用到的一些流下面我们来一个个的介绍其
从一个文件按字节读取,输出到控制台
原创
2013-05-20 22:07:54
434阅读
InputStream是Java标准库提供的最基本的输入流,位于java.io包里,InputStream是一个抽象类,是所有输入流的超类FileInputStream是InputStream的子类,就是从文件流中读取数据。FileInputStream是读取一个文件来作InputStream。BufferedInputStream是缓存输入流。继承于FilterInputStream。作用是为另
转载
2024-04-08 14:18:24
40阅读
如果用inputStream对象的available()方法获取流中可读取的数据大小,通常我们调用这个函数是在下载文件或者对文件进行其他处理时获取文件的总大小。 以前在我们初学File和inputStream和outputStream时,有需要将文件从一个文件夹复制到另一个文件夹中,这时候我们用的就是inputStream.available()来获取文件的总大小
转载
2024-03-21 07:22:33
87阅读
FileInputStream 是 Java 中用于读取文件的一个常用类,它可以让程序从指定的文件中读取数据。在 Linux 系统中,FileInputStream 类同样可以被使用来操作文件。在 Linux 中,文件是一切的基础,它们可以是文本文件、可执行文件、配置文件等等,而通过使用 FileInputStream 类,我们可以轻松读取这些文件的内容。
Linux 是一个开源的操作系统,广泛
原创
2024-03-26 11:15:35
30阅读
目录一、File类1、定义2、属性3、构造方法4、方法(1)、获取文件路径 (2)、文件的创建和删除(3)、目录的创建二、InputStream和OutputStream1、InputStream(1)、FileInputStream(2)、利用Scanner 进行字符读取2、OutputStream(1)、FileOutputStream 一、File类1、定义Java中通过
转载
2023-07-28 23:54:09
285阅读
/*
* IO流的分类
* 1、有多种分类方式
* 一种方式是按照流的方向进行分类
* 以内存作为参照物
* 往内存中去,叫做输入(input),或者读(read)
* 从内存中出来,叫做输出(output),或者写(write)
* 另一种是按照读取
简介FileInputStream和FileOutputStream都是用来处理二进制数据源磁盘文件的流的。 他们分别派生自顶层抽象类InputStream和OutputStream FileInputStream 作用:用于从文件系统中的某个文件中获得输入字节,处理二进制原始字节文件,如exe 图片等。
1、构造关联 的文件可以使用 String 描
转载
2024-04-26 17:39:41
24阅读
一、File首先我们要先了解文件路径:文件路径分为 绝对路径 和 相对路径 两种。绝对路径:相对于树来说就是,从根节点到叶子结点的整个路径。windows即是从各个磁盘 下开始到目标文件的整个路径。相对路径:可以从任意结点出发,到目标文件进行路径的描述,而这种描
转载
2023-08-26 20:53:20
67阅读
当读写文件时,需要确保有适当的文件锁定机制,来保证基于并发I/O应用程序的数据完整性。本教程中, 我们将介绍使用 Java NIO 库实现这一点的各种方法。# 文件锁简介「一般来说,有两种锁」:独占锁——也称为写锁共享锁——也称为读锁简单地说,在写操作完成时,独占锁防止所有其他操作(包括读操作)。相反,共享锁允许多个进程同时读取。读锁的目的是防止另一个进程获取写锁。通常,处于一致状态的文件
文件读取FileInputStream
FileReader 文件写入FileOutputStreamFileWriter随机文件读写RandomAccessFile一.文件读取 FileInputStream和FileReader是文件字节输入流和文件字符输入流,都是提供文件读取功能,只是读取形式不同,一个以字节为最小单位读取,一个以字符为最小单位读取,并且两者都必须从文件头开始,按
转载
2024-02-09 12:09:41
29阅读
1. 源起 需要跟踪FileInputStream的Read的Nativie实现,开始走了弯路,Java工程下的FileInputStream实现与Android工程的实现
转载
2013-08-16 19:17:00
118阅读
# 了解Android Java中的FileInputStream
在Android开发中,常常需要处理文件读取操作。FileInputStream类是Java中用于从文件系统中读取字节数据的类,它是InputStream的子类。在本文中,我们将介绍如何在Android Java中使用FileInputStream类进行文件读取操作。
## FileInputStream类简介
FileIn
# Java中的FileInputStream错误处理指南
在Java编程中,`FileInputStream`是用于从文件中读取字节的一个重要类。对于刚入行的新手,可能会在使用`FileInputStream`时遇到一些常见的错误。本文将提供一个详细的实现步骤,并在每一步中提供必要的代码示例、解释和注释,帮助你理解并解决可能出现的问题。
## 整体流程
我们将通过以下几个步骤来处理`Fil